One Family's Story

The McDonald family, after a year long wait for rental assistance, was able to lease their Housing Choice Voucher in-place .

Teresa, a stay-at-home mother, was devastated after a tragic car accident claimed the life of her husband in 2002. The family's sole income was her husband's private business. Teresa now had to handle the family finances, which were primarily expenses; her young family also had to work through their loss.

Teresa, Dillon, Kayley, and Colton are moving forward and with their Housing Choice Voucher Rental Assistance they don't have to worry about having a home.

"If it wasn't for Walla Walla Housing Authority, I don't know where we would be today. We couldn't get through the month-to-month struggle -- the assistance has really saved us."
